Context

Established in 1965, Housing Matters is a specialist housing advice, support, and advocacy charity in Bristol. We believe quality housing is a human right. We’re here to give anyone in and around Bristol the knowledge and support they need to live in safe, secure homes. We provide clients with specialist advice, practical support, and legal advocacy. We have a strong focus on homelessness prevention, especially in areas of high socio-economic deprivation.
